Membuat Program C++ Biodata dengan Tipe Data

Program C++ Membuat Biodata


Source Code :

#include<stdio.h>

#include<conio.h>

#include<iostream>

using namespace std;

struct tinggal

{

char jalan[40];

char kota[15];

char pos[5];

};

struct tgl_lahir

{

int tanggal;

int bulan;

int tahun;

};

struct mahasiswa

{

char nim[9];

char nama[25];

tinggal alamat;

tgl_lahir lahir;

};

main()

{

mahasiswa mhs[5];

int i;

for(i=0;i<3;i++)

{

cout<<"------------------------------------------------"<<endl;

cout<<"Masukkan biodata mahasiswa dengan benar"<<endl;

cout<<"------------------------------------------------"<<endl;

cout<<"NIM : "; cin>>mhs[i].nim;

cout<<"Nama : "; cin>>mhs[i].nama;

cout<<"Alamat Lengkap "<<endl;

cout<<"\tJalan   : "; cin>>mhs[i].alamat.jalan;

cout<<"\tKota   : "; cin>>mhs[i].alamat.kota;

cout<<"\tKode Pos  : "; cin>>mhs[i].alamat.pos;

cout<<"Tanggal Lahir"<<endl;

cout<<"\tTanggal    : "; cin>>mhs[i].lahir.tanggal;

cout<<"\tBulan    : "; cin>>mhs[i].lahir.bulan;

cout<<"\tTahun    : "; cin>>mhs[i].lahir.tahun; 

cout<<endl<<endl;

}

system("cls");

for(i=0;i<3;i++)

{

cout<<"------------------------------------------------"<<endl;

cout<<"Mencetak kembali data Mahasiswa"<<endl;

cout<<"------------------------------------------------"<<endl;

cout<<endl<<"NIM : "<<mhs[i].nim;

cout<<endl<<"Nama : "<<mhs[i].nama;

cout<<endl<<"Alamat Lengkap";

cout<<endl<<"\tJalan  : "<<mhs[i].alamat.jalan;

cout<<endl<<"\tKota     : "<<mhs[i].alamat.kota;

cout<<endl<<"\tKode Pos : "<<mhs[i].alamat.pos;

cout<<endl<<"Tanggal Lahir : "<<mhs[i].lahir.tanggal<<"-";

cout<<mhs[i].lahir.bulan<<"-"<<mhs[i].lahir.tahun;

cout<<endl<<endl;

cout<<endl<<endl;

}

cout<<"Created by : Thesallonika KS"<<endl;

cout<<"Politeknik Pratama Mulia Surakarta"<<endl;

cout<<"2023"<<endl;

getch();

}



Hasil dari program diatas sebagai berikut :

Comments

Popular posts from this blog

Membuat Program C++ Menggunakan Array